利用 JavaScript 调用 `` 标签链接的 SEO 最佳实践318
`` 标签是超文本标记语言 (HTML) 中的基本元素,用于创建文本或图像链接。在传统情况下,这些链接通过直接编写链接的目标 URL 来指定。然而,可以通过 JavaScript 动态更改链接的目标,在某些情况下提供灵活性优势。
使用 JavaScript 调用 `` 链接要使用 JavaScript 调用 `` 链接,您需要使用以下步骤: SEO 影响使用 JavaScript 调用 `` 链接会对搜索引擎优化 (SEO) 产生影响。以下是需要考虑的一些方面: 可爬行性:搜索引擎需要能够爬取网站才能对其内容进行索引。如果 JavaScript 链接与页面内容不相关,它们可能会被错过,导致 SEO 性能下降。 索引: JavaScript 生成的链接可能不会被搜索引擎正确索引,因为它们不在源代码中直接指定。这可能会导致丢失链接权益和其他 SEO 问题。 可访问性: JavaScript 可能被浏览器禁用或不兼容,这会导致链接无法使用。这会影响用户的体验和网站的可访问性。 最佳实践为了优化使用 JavaScript 调用 `` 链接,请遵循以下最佳实践: 正确使用:仅在必要时使用 JavaScript 来调用链接。避免用于不重要的或重复的内容。 渐进增强:将 JavaScript 链接作为传统链接的渐进增强,以确保无 JavaScript 用户也能访问内容。 使用事件处理程序:将 JavaScript 链接绑定到事件处理程序,例如 `onclick` 或 `onmouseover`,以避免在页面加载时不必要地调用链接。 明确目的:确保 JavaScript 链接的目的是显而易见的,并且与页面内容相关。避免使用模糊或通用的链接文本。 使用与传统链接相同的规范:确保 JavaScript 链接遵守与传统链接相同的 SEO 规范,包括使用描述性链接文本和适当的链接属性。 替代方案在某些情况下,有替代方法可以在不使用 JavaScript 的情况下实现类似的行为。这些包括: 服务器端重定向:在服务器端重定向用户到所需的页面,而不是使用 JavaScript。 `` 刷新:使用 `` 刷新标头来自动将用户重定向到指定 URL。 `` 元素:使用 `` 元素与 JavaScript 事件处理程序结合来模拟链接行为。 2025-01-07 上一篇:a标签的双标签特性及优化技巧
1. 获取 `` 元素的引用:使用 `()` 或 `()`。
2. 设置链接的 `href` 属性:使用 `` 属性。
以下代码示例演示如何使用 JavaScript 调用 `` 链接:
```javascript
const link = ("a");
= "";
```
使用 JavaScript 调用 `` 链接可以提供灵活性,但在 SEO 方面需要仔细考虑。通过遵循最佳实践并探索替代方案,您可以最大限度地减少对 SEO 的负面影响,同时利用 JavaScript 的优势。记住,渐进增强和谨慎使用对于保持网站的可访问性和搜索引擎友好性至关重要。